Full Job Description

Bank Domestic Housekeeping Supervisor. Covering hospital sites in Workington, Maryport, Keswick, Cockermouth and Wigton. Coverage for sickness and annual leave, as and when required. Shifts can occur between 6am-8pm, depending on site. To Supervise a team of Housekeeping staff in providing good quality, safe catering and cleanliness services to wards and departments throughout Trust premises for all staff, patients and visitors. To promote and provide a high standard of domestic services and in house catering All staff are expected to work to the trust values Kindness, Respect, Ambition & Collaboration Adhere to trust policies and procedures, attend mandatory training, Manage staff distribution across the departments and sites and make adjustments as and when necessary depending on staffing levels. Ensure adequate staffing levels are maintained to cover the service needs Supervise all staff and monitor standards of work throughout their shift, Demonstrate duties and be responsible for the training of new and existing staff, Deal effectively and efficiently with all departmental problems and complaints, Motivate staff and maintain effective communication Complete weekly timesheets, monitor and maintain sickness records for all staff, completing all necessary paperwork & recording on the ESR System Adhere to Trust Infection Prevention Policies Be responsible for maintaining a healthy, safe and secure working environment, ensure all equipment is in good working order, is checked, maintained and recorded. Maintain a positive Trust image at all times, ensuring security of the department at all times, adequate preparation for the following days shifts to be completed to meet the needs of the service Delegate daily tasks and monitor work to maintain a high cleanliness standard throughout. Ensure a safe meal regeneration and delivery service is in operation on a daily basis Ensure all cleaning schedules are adhered too, deal with any problems and complaints straight away, Please see attached job description and person specification for further information regarding the role and the essential and desirable criteria required to be met by applicants.,

    This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ions. The cost of the DBS must be met by the successful candidate(s) through salary deduction. DBS charges are as follows if applicable to the post: Standard Check: £21.50 + Administration cost of £6.50 = £28.00 Deducted from salary over a 4 month period or a one-off payment. Enhanced Check: £49.50 + administration cost of £6.50 = £56.00 Deducted from salary over a 4 month period or a one-off payment.
